Understanding Car Key Cases
Car key cases are the protective housings for the electronic parts and battery of car keys. They are created to safeguard the internal systems from wear and tear due to daily usage. Nevertheless, over time and with regular handling, these cases can end up being scratched, broken, or broken, jeopardizing not only the aesthetic appeal however possibly the functionality of the key itself.

Repairing a car key case can vary from DIY solutions to professional services. Here are numerous techniques to consider when faced with a damaged key case:
DIY Repair Techniques
Super Glue for Cracks: For small cracks in plastic key fobs, a top quality very glue can efficiently bond the split back together.

Epoxy for Breaks: For more substantial breaks, a two-part epoxy is recommended, supplying a more powerful hold after treating.

Replacing Buttons: If buttons are used, they can in some cases be replaced using button sets readily available online. Additionally, you can use silicone sealant to develop new buttons.

Cleaning up and Drying: In the event of water direct exposure, quickly dismantling the key fob, air-drying the elements, and utilizing rubbing alcohol to clean may salvage the electronics.

Protective Covers: To prevent repeating damage, consider investing in a protective silicone case that fits over the key.
